Released in 1994 under the Hyperion label, this exquisite collection showcases Coletti's virtuosity on the viola, accompanied by the masterful piano playing of Leslie Howard. The album spans a diverse range of compositions, from the hauntingly beautiful "Elegy for Solo Viola" by Benjamin Britten to the soothing melodies of Rebecca Clarke's "Lullaby" and "Morpheus." Ralph Vaughan Williams' "Romance" and Percy Grainger's arrangements add further depth and variety to the repertoire.
